As a Residential Youth Specialist, you will be primarily responsible for providing care and supervising residents in the program. This individual will serve as a positive role model to help encourage, teach, and shape the lives of adolescent male youth in our residential treatment facility. Youth in care need guidance and influence in order to become a more productive citizen once they leave placement.
The Youth Specialist is scheduled approximately 40 hours per week, primarily on 2nd shift during the week (3pm - 11pm), and either 1st or 2nd shift on the weekends, depending on the needs of the unit. There are three youth specialists on a shift.
This position is expected to function effectively with moderate supervision while following the guidelines given on procedures, along with agency, federal, and state regulatory requirements.
